UP FEATURES: As renumbered to 3470-3775 in 2012 3681 as repainted with flag, June 2015 EOTD holder between starter capacitor box and fuel gauge Front only ditch lights mounted on pilot face Both Cab door options, with and without window Union Pacific specific cab antennas Union Pacific was the largest buyer of the SD90MAC with 309 units total; the railroad designation was SD9043AC as they were delivered with the 710G engine rated at 4300hp. Taking delivery of the first locomotives in 1995 and the last in 1999; originally numbered in the 8000 series, these locomotives were renumbered in 2012 and some are still in service today. 3681 is one of only a few SD90MACs to receive the flag paint scheme.
